-
Notifications
You must be signed in to change notification settings - Fork 0
Home
I. Formulaire d’ajout d’une icône
- L'importation de l’icône
- Les topics
- Les tags
- Les attributs
- Les sources
- Les icônes existantes
- La maquette
II. Fiche d’une icône
La première réflexion portera sur une des fonctions primordiale de notre futur système, l'ajout d'icônes qui se fera en remplissant un formulaire.
La première fonctionnalité fournie par le formulaire sera un module d’importation d’image. Cette fonctionnalité d'importation d'images n'est pour l'instant pas présente. Elle permettra à l’utilisateur de sélectionner sur son ordinateur une icône et de l’importer sur le serveur. Pour ce faire, un module sera à la disposition de l’utilisateur comme il en existe sur divers sites sur internet (voir l’illustration 1). Illustration 1 : Module d’importation d’images de Google +
L’importation de l’image sera la première étape lors de l’ajout d’une icône. Néanmoins l’utilisateur peut commencer par remplir les autres parties du formulaire sans problèmes.
Une icône appartiendra à un topic. Au premier niveau de l’arborescence, nous trouvons les points de vue. Nous les appelons points de vue car il s’agit d’une façon de voir les choses, ainsi nous trouvons les points de vue économique, écologiques et bien d’autres encore. Les points de vue contiennent de 1 à n topics, ce sont des notions plus concrètes mais encore générales par exemple le topic général « Transport » du point de vue « Environnement ». Ensuite un topic contiendra éventuellement des sous-topics et éventuellement des icônes (voir illustration 2).
 Illustration 2 : L’arborescence
Le point de vue ainsi que le(s) « topic(s) » d’une icône seront décrits dans le formulaire lors de la création d’une icône.
Deux cas peuvent exister :
Soit l’utilisateur à naviguer dans l’arborescence des topics avant de lancer la création d’une icône auquel cas le système considère que le dernier topic est celui de l’icône. Dans ce cas, l’espace consacré au choix du topic est pré-rempli. L’utilisateur peut néanmoins modifier le topic ou bien en ajouté un autre. Soit l’utilisateur à lancer la création d’une icône sans avoir au préalable naviguer dans l’arborescence des topics auquel cas, le module de choix des topics pour l’icône restera vide et l’utilisateur sera amené à en proposer au moins un.
Une fois que l’icône sera créée par le formulaire, l’icône sera consultable dans les topics où elle a été définie.
Lorsqu’un utilisateur ajoute une icône, il a la possibilité et il lui est conseillé d’ajouter des tags à cette icône, de lui associer des mots-clés qui la caractérisent ou la décrivent.
Justement pour décrire une image, nous utilisons fréquemment plusieurs notions, plusieurs points de vue sous lesquels regarder cette icône telles que :
La couleur : elle pourrait être une bonne façon de décrire une icône hors les icônes de notre annuaire seront en quelque sorte formatées, elles auront une couleur et une forme selon leurs topics. Autant donc ne pas faire doublon avec les topics de l’icône que l’utilisateur devra renseigner.
La ou les formes géométriques : comme évoqué plus haut, la forme globale de l’icône sera formatée selon le topic auquel elle appartient.
Les objets : il s’agit des objets identifiables sur l’icône, prenons par exemple l’illustration 3, de ce point de vue nous pourrions ajouter un tag « Erlenmeyer » et une fois la forme et la couleur ajoutées, l’objet reste ce qui permet d’en faire un motif de tag durable.
 Illustration 3 : exemple d’icône représentant un « erlenmeyer »
A approfondir : Existe-t-il d’autres façons de regarder une icône ?
Une icône pourra également être caractérisée par des attributs communs à toutes les icônes. On peut d’ores et déjà penser à certains attributs tels que
Un nom : Une icône aura un nom qui la plupart du temps sera la notion qu’elle représente. Un responsable : Une icône aura un responsable à savoir la plupart du temps la personne qui l’a postée mais on pourrait permettre à cette personne de nommer un autre responsable. Ce rôle est lié à de nouveaux concepts expliqués plus loin. Une date : Une icône aura une date qui sera bien souvent la date d’ajout de l’icône dans le système. Néanmoins certaines icônes sont ajoutées en tant que schéma qui pourra être re-dessiner par un graphiste. Dans ce cas quelle date devra-t-on retenir ? A approfondir Un statut : Comme évoqué plus haut, des icônes postées peuvent être encore à l’état de croquis ou d’icône pas encore normalisée, il est donc intéressant d’indiquer dans quelle phase se trouve cette icône. Cela permet ainsi au dessinateur de savoir si ils peuvent entreprendre la tache de dessiner plus avant l’icône. (Voir illustration 4)  Illustration 4 : Les statuts d’une icône : croquis, icône aboutie
Une icône possédera également des sources qui lui seront attachés. Par exemple l’image de l’icône sera un fichier source qui sera attaché à l’icône. Le responsable de l’icône pourra ainsi rajouter d’autres sources.
Enfin une dernière fonctionnalité qu’il serait intéressant de proposer dans le formulaire d’ajout d’une icône est d’avoir un aperçu des icônes déjà présentes dans la base à droite du formulaire. De ce fait il pourra par exemple juger si une icône semblable existe déjà auquel cas il ne serait pas nécessaire de l’ajouter.
Mais nous pouvons nous demander quelles icônes nous devront afficher. En effet lorsque seront intégrées des centaines d’icônes dans la base, lesquelles afficher ? Il semble évident que les icônes à afficher en priorité seront celles liées aux topics que l’utilisateur choisira. Si je souhaite ajouter une icône dans le topic « Internet », il semble logique que nous affichions en priorité les icônes du topic « Internet ». Ensuite nous pouvons affiner l’ordre d’affichage de ces icônes. Par exemple nous pourrions afficher en dernier celles que l’utilisateur actuel a éventuellement posté, en effet on peut partir du principe qu’un utilisateur se souvient qu’elles ont été les icônes qu’il a posté. On peut également partir sur l’idée d’afficher dans un encadré à part les icônes de l’utilisateur. Voir la maquette (Illustration 5). On peut afficher dans les icônes du topic, en premier celles qui ont un tag en commun avec l’icône en cours d’ajout.
 Illustration 5 : maquette du formulaire d’ajout d’une icône
La maquette sur l’illustration 5 réunit les éléments évoqués ci-dessus. Dans la partie gauche, nous pouvons voir le formulaire. Dans celui-ci, l’utilisateur « upload » dans un premier temps l’image de l’icône, puis renseigne les topics, les tags, les sources. Dans la partie droite nous pouvons voir la zone où apparaîtront les icônes déjà présentes.
Une fois créer par le formulaire présenté ci-dessus, une icône pourra être consultable. Après mures réflexion il ne semble pas nécessaire d'interdire à certaines catégories d’utilisateurs, la consultation des fiches des icônes du fait de l’absence de données sensibles.
Les fiches seront les cartes d’identité de nos icônes, elles réuniront les informations les concernant. De ce fait elles reprendront les données qui ont été saisies lors de leurs importations ainsi que différents outils qui permettront à nos utilisateurs de collaborer. Il est donc pas nécessaire de re-présenter la structure d’une fiche ainsi que les informations affichées.